Output 84ddc317a2aa64f3de70b4cf9c8e75cb87e41b216df2eb99247b7b8c7e620892:1

value
154172
script pubkey
OP_0 OP_PUSHBYTES_20 e9e653ec64d77703a5d75cf9e5f4151c187016ac
address
ltc1qa8n98mry6ams8fwhtnu7taq4rsv8q94vk3vy6g
transaction
84ddc317a2aa64f3de70b4cf9c8e75cb87e41b216df2eb99247b7b8c7e620892
spent
true